First off.. please do NOT bid or offer me any cash for this item. I found it in a junkyard and picked it up and want to see how many folks might be interested in it. I have a couple of friends that might also be interested in this spoiler as well. The status of this item will be determined by weeks end. I found it on a 92 RS. Its teal and the garnish and seals are in good condition. The spoiler itself will need to be repainted due to the clear coat pealing in large areas. But the body of the spoiler is free from major damage.. a simple sand, primer and paint will see it nice. If this spoiler comes up for sale, I will post pics of it at that time in the for sale post.

Yeah, I know I have been gone forever, but you know if I see something that would be valuable to the MX-3 community.. I would share it rather than watch it crushed.
